Output 37d21486c102cd9a52489ca864e24a33a50e91ba3e6cfcac0cd4d4d7f19cf79c:10

value
3238528
script pubkey
OP_0 OP_PUSHBYTES_20 3d70d4d15cf4ce0d245115ec81e9d0613ee8f5e2
address
bc1q84cdf52u7n8q6fz3zhkgr6wsvylw3a0z7ywdt2
transaction
37d21486c102cd9a52489ca864e24a33a50e91ba3e6cfcac0cd4d4d7f19cf79c
spent
true